THE KEYS The keys allow you to switch on the ignition and to independentlyoperate the front doors, the fuelfiller cap, the glove box and thepassenger air bag disarmingswitch. Central locking
From the driver's door, the keys allow you to lock, deadlock orunlock the doors and the tailgateand to fold back the exterior mir-rors. If one of the doors or the boot is open, it is impossible to operatethe central locking; an audiblesignal indicates locking by remo-te control. The remote control performs the same functions at a distance. The remote control key Locking Press button
Ato lock the vehicle.
This is confirmed by fixed lighting of the direction indicators forapproximately two seconds. Note: a long press on button A,
in addition to deadlocking, auto- matically closes the windows.
Vehicles fitted with deadlocking
Deadlocking renders theinternal and external doorlocking controls inoperative.
Press button Ato deadlock the
vehicle. This is confirmed by fixed lighting of the direction indicators forapproximately two seconds. Note : a long press on button A
permits automatic closing of the windows, in addition to deadloc-king.
A second press on button Ain
the five seconds following dead- locking, changes deadlocking tonormal locking. This is confirmed by fixed lighting of the direction indicators forapproximately two seconds.
Unlocking Press button Bto unlock the
vehicle. This is confirmed by rapid flashing of the direction indicators. Note : If the vehicle is locked
and unlocking is activated inad- vertently without the doors beingopened within 30 seconds,the vehicle will re-lock
automatically.

AIR BAGS The air bag system has been desi- gned to maximise the safety of theoccupants in the event of seriouscollisions. It works in conjunctionwith the force limiting seat belts. Front air bags These are folded in the centre of the steering wheel for the driverand in the fascia for the front
passenger. They are deployed
simultaneously, except in caseswhere the passenger air bag isdisarmed. Precautions regarding the pas- senger air bag disarm the air bag if you ins- tall a rear facing child seat,
activate the air bag for an
adult passenger. Disarming the passengerair bag*
with the ignition off, insert the key into slot 1and turn the
passenger air bag switch tothe "OFF" position.
As soon as you remove the childseat, turn the air bag switch to the"ON" position, to activate the air
bag again.
Operating check
With the ignition switched on (2nd notch), illumina-tion of the warning light,accompanied by an
audible signal and the message"Passenger air bag disarmed"
on the multi-function display, indi-cates that the passenger air bag isdisarmed (switch in the "OFF"
position). The warning light remains on throughout the disarming process. Side air bags* and curtain air bags* Side air bags are incorporated into the front seat back frame, on thedoor side. Curtain air bags are incorporated into the door pillars and the top ofthe passenger compartment. They are deployed independently
of each other, depending on whichside the collision occurs.

GENERAL FUNCTIONSOn/off With the ignition key in the accessories or ignition position, press button Ato switch the set on or off.
The set can operate for 30 minutes without the vehicle ignition being switched on.
Anti-theft systemThe audio system is coded in such a way that it can operate only on your vehicle. It would not function if fitted to another vehicle. The anti-theft system is automatic and requires no action on your part. ADJUSTING THE VOLUME Press button Cto increase the volume, or button Bto decrease it.
Continuous pressure on buttons Cand Ballows a gradual adjustment of the volume.
AUDIO SETTINGS Press button Hseveral times in succession to access the bass (BASS), treble (TREB), loudness (LOUD),
fader (FAD) , balance (BAL) and automatic volume correction settings.
Exit from audio mode is automatic after a few seconds without pressing any button, or by pressing button H
after configuration of the automatic volume correction. Note : bass and treble settings are specific to each source. It is possible to set them differently for radio,
cassette (RB3), CD ( RD3)and CD changer.

GENERAL FUNCTIONS On/off With the ignition switch in the accessories position or with the ignition on, press button Ato switch the audio
function of the RT3 audio/telephone on or off. Note: in the absence of an ignition key, press button Ato switch the telematics system on or off.
The RT3 audio/telephone can operate for 30 minutes without switching the vehicle ignition on.
Notes:
- the SIM card must be removed only after the audio/telephone has been switched off,
- following automatic switching off of the audio/telephone after 30 minutes it is possible to make a telephone call by pressing button D,
- after the ignition has been switched off, the audio/telephone can be switched on again by pressing buttons D, E , V or by
inserting a CD in the player.
Anti-theft system
The RT3 audio/telephone is coded in such a way that it can operate only on your vehicle. If fitting it to another vehicle, cons ult
your PEUGEOT dealer for configuration of the system. The anti-theft system is automatic and requires no action on your part. ADJUSTING THE VOLUME
Turn button Aclockwise to increase the volume of the audio/telephone or anti-clockwise to decrease it.
Note: the volume setting is specific to each source. It is possible to have different settings for radio, CD or CD changer.
AUDIO SETTINGS Press button Uto access Bass, Treble , Loudness , Fader (front/rear balance), Balance(left/right balance)
and Automatic volume adjustment settings.
Exit from audio mode is automatic after a few seconds without any action, or by pressing the "ESC" button.
Note: bass, treble and loudness settings are specific to each source. It is possible to have different settings
for radio, CD or CD changer.

TELEPHONE
This function is a GSM dual-band telephone (900 and 1 800 MHz) incorporated in the RT3 audio system. It is a ''hands free'' telephone. This function is provided by a microphone located next to the front courtesy light, the
speakers and a steering column control which allows access to most of the functions (the audio/telephone control panel buttons allow access to all the functions). Display of the principal ''mobile''type functions, as well as consultation of the indexes, is provided by the multi-function
display.This function is active , whatever position the ignition key is in even after thirty minutes, when the message ''Economy
mode active'' appears on the multi-function display.
Using the menus Press the ''MENU'' button to display the general menu. Select the telematicsapplication, validiate "Telephone functions"
to access the principal telephone functions, then the various menus, in order to reach the one required. This menu allows you to access the following functions:
- Network: allows you to select the network search mode and to see the networks avai-
lable.
- Duration of calls: allows you to consult the duration recorder of calls made and zero
re-set.
- Security: allows you to use or modify the PIN code and to erase the list of calls and
mini-messages (SMS).
- Telephone options: allows you to configure the calls with entering of my number,
automatic answering after X rings, specification of ring options and allows you to confi-
gure the call diversion number.
Within each menu: Move around and select a function by turning the Gbutton then validate by pressing the button.
Cancel an operation using the ''ESC''button.
